Keep Your Low Rate

If you locked a mortgage rate below 4% during 2020 to 2022, a HELOC lets you access equity without touching your existing loan. A cash-out refinance would replace your low rate with today's higher rates, a HELOC avoids that.

Draw Only What You Need

A HELOC is a revolving credit line. You draw funds as needed during the draw period and only pay interest on the outstanding balance. If you draw $20,000 of a $100,000 line, you pay interest on $20,000.

Flexible Uses

Use your HELOC for home improvements, education expenses, emergency reserves, debt consolidation, or investment opportunities. Funds are available via check, transfer, or card depending on the lender.

Interest-Only Payments

During the draw period (typically 5 to 10 years), most HELOCs require interest-only payments on the outstanding balance. This keeps your monthly obligation low while funds are accessible.

Up to 90% CLTV

Many HELOC products allow a combined loan-to-value ratio of up to 90%, giving Louisiana homeowners access to a significant portion of their equity while keeping a reasonable cushion.

What Is a HELOC and How Does It Work for Louisiana Homeowners?

A Home Equity Line of Credit (HELOC) is a revolving credit line secured by your home. Unlike a cash-out refinance, which replaces your entire mortgage with a new loan, a HELOC sits on top of your existing mortgage as a second lien. You draw funds as needed during the draw period (typically 5 to 10 years), then repay during the repayment period (typically 10 to 20 years). Interest rates on HELOCs are usually variable, tied to the Prime Rate.

For Louisiana homeowners who locked mortgage rates between 2.5% and 4.5% during 2020 to 2022, a HELOC is often far more cost-effective than a cash-out refinance. Replacing a 3% mortgage with a 7% cash-out refinance would increase your interest expense on the entire loan balance. A HELOC only charges interest on the amount you actually draw, preserving your low first mortgage rate while giving you flexible access to equity.

  • Revolving credit line. Draw funds as needed, pay back, draw again
  • Keeps your existing mortgage and rate intact (second lien position)
  • Variable interest rate tied to Prime Rate (currently around 8.5%)
  • Draw period of 5 to 10 years with interest-only minimum payments
  • Repayment period of 10 to 20 years with principal and interest payments
  • Available for homeowners with 15%+ equity in all 64 Louisiana parishes

A HELOC is a revolving credit line that sits on top of your existing mortgage. You keep your current rate and only pay interest on what you draw. A cash-out refinance replaces your entire mortgage with a new, larger loan at today's rates. For homeowners with low existing rates, a HELOC is usually more cost-effective.
Most HELOC lenders require a minimum 680 credit score, with the best terms available at 720+. Your combined loan-to-value ratio, debt-to-income ratio, and income stability also factor into approval.
Most lenders require at least 15% to 20% equity in your home after the HELOC. Combined loan-to-value (CLTV) limits typically range from 80% to 90% depending on the lender and your credit profile.
Yes. Most HELOCs carry variable interest rates tied to the Prime Rate. As Prime rises or falls, your HELOC rate adjusts accordingly. Some lenders offer fixed-rate conversion options that let you lock a portion of your balance at a fixed rate.
The draw period is typically 5 to 10 years during which you can access funds and make interest-only payments. After the draw period ends, you enter the repayment period (10 to 20 years) where you repay principal and interest.
Yes, and this is one of the most common uses. Interest on HELOC funds used for home improvements may be tax-deductible (consult a tax professional). Louisiana homeowners frequently use HELOCs for kitchen and bathroom renovations, roof replacement, and hurricane hardening.
A HELOC offers flexible, revolving access to funds. Ideal for ongoing projects or uncertain expenses. A home equity loan provides a fixed lump sum with a fixed rate, better for one-time, defined needs. We help Louisiana homeowners determine which structure fits their situation.
Yes. Most HELOCs have no prepayment penalty. You can pay down or pay off the balance at any time during the draw or repayment period.
No, but the HELOC balance must be paid off at closing when you sell. The proceeds from the sale pay off both your first mortgage and the HELOC. If your equity covers both, the process is straightforward.
